The Platinum Card From American Express

This card comes with a hefty annual fee of $550, but it’s worth it if you plan on doing any traveling. You’ll earn 60,000 membership rewards points for your first $5000 in purchases within 3 months.

The rewards don’t stop there – you’ll earn five points for every dollar spent on airline travel booked with American Express Travel. You’ll also earn this benefit on eligible hotel purchases booked with amextravel.com.

Finally, earn one point for every dollar spent on regular purchases.

Citi Double Cash Card

The Citi Double Cash Card is a great holiday credit card because it allows for zero percent balance transfers for the first 18 months. Not to mention that there’s no annual fee. The variable APR is 15.74% to 25.74% on purchases and balance transfers after the 18-month introductory period.

The best part about this card, you’ll earn 2 percent cash back on every purchase.

Chase Sapphire Preferred Card

This card offers no annual fee for the first year. You’ll pay $95 per year thereafter. The major perk to this card is the 50,000 bonus points you’ll earn for the first $4000 spent on purchases in the first three months from account opening. You’ll also earn 2 points on travel and restaurants worldwide as well as 1 point for every dollar spent on all other purchases.

Discover it® Cash Back

Another one of the best credit cards for holiday shopping is the Discover it® Cash Back credit card. With no annual fee and up to 5% cash back on purchases in rotating categories, this is an excellent card any time of year.

This card carries a zero percent introductory offer for the first 14 months on purchases and balance transfers. The APR is a variable of 13.99% to 24.99% after that.

The best part about this card is the Discover match program which rewards you with double the cash back at the end of your first year.

Wells Fargo Platinum Visa Card

The Wells Fargo Platinum Visa Card has a zero percent APR on all purchases and balance transfers for the first 18 months from the time you open your card. You’ll also enjoy no annual fee and other perks like easy access to your FICO credit score and up to $600 for cell phone protection if your cell phone bill is paid with your card.

Regular APR is 17.74% to 27.24% variable.

Target REDcard

The Target REDcard is a great choice for shoppers that spend a lot of time at their favorite store. You’ll enjoy no annual fee and 5% savings on all purchases at Target and Target.com. Not to mention an additional 30 days to return items in store or online and free shipping at Target.com.

The variable APR for this card is a bit steep at 25.15% variable so make sure to pay it off at the end of every month.

Costco Anywhere Visa® by Citi

The best credit card for Christmas shopping if you’re a Costco member is none other than the Costco Anywhere Visa® by Citi. Enjoy no annual fee with your paid Costco membership and earn up to 4% cash back on eligible gas purchases worldwide. You’ll also earn the following rewards on eligible purchases:

  • 3% cash back at restaurants
  • 3% cash back on travel
  • 2% cash back on Costco purchases
  • 1% cash back on all other purchases

You’ll need excellent credit to qualify.

Amazon Prime Rewards Visa

Of course, the best shopping credit card if you’re an Amazon fan is the Amazon Prime Rewards Visa card. You’ll receive a $70 gift card upon approval to spend at Amazon.com and a generous 5% cash back on all Amazon purchases.

Earn 2% cash back at restaurants, drugstores, and gas stations, as well as 1% cash back on all other purchases with this card. There’s no annual fee and the interest rate is 15.99% to 23.99% variable.

Remember, when applying for credit cards, it’s best to do it all at once in order to preserve your credit score. Each credit card application counts as an inquiry on your credit report which will last for two years.
